WebJan 15, 2024 · Liver shunt is a well known malady that can afflict Irish Wolfhound puppies resulting in severe illness or death by 4-5 months of age. Your breeder should test the litter with a simple blood test (bile acid) at about 9 weeks of age. WebGreat Lakes Irish Wolfhound Association (GLIWA) subscribes to the Irish Wolfhound Club of America, Inc. standard of behavior for breeders. The purpose of breeding Irish Wolfhounds is to bring the Breed Standard to life. One should never breed for personal profit or commercial exploitation of the breed.
